What to Look For in Wholesale Chocolate and Sweets
Before you place a commercial order, examine the basics that affect both margins and customer satisfaction. Look for clear information on product variety, sizes, ingredient transparency, and whether items are suitable for the type of store you run. Businesses that wholesale sweets carry gift selections often need reliable packaging and dependable product labeling, while convenience retailers may prioritize fast-moving staples. Strong supplier communication reduces the risk of mismatched expectations and helps you plan promotions with confidence.
For programs, variety and repeatability matter as much as pricing. A smart range covers different price points, such as everyday chocolate bars alongside indulgent novelty items and shareable sizes. It’s also helpful when a supplier can support cross-category buying, letting you build a cohesive candy wall that encourages impulse purchases. When your assortment is intentional, you can improve conversion rates and reduce stock stagnation, especially for products that depend on gifting, events, or seasonal consumer habits.
One practical approach is to request sample packs or smaller trial orders, then evaluate sell-through once products hit the floor. Track which items attract the most attention, which sell quickly, and which require better shelf placement or promotional support. A supplier that supports retailer feedback can help refine your selection for better performance over time.
